ARB
Old Man Emu 2.5" HD
Lift kit:
In
order to fit larger
tires and gain ground
clearance we went to ARB
for there reputable OME
lift system. The ride
this lift kit provides
is better than factory
and weight rated coils
along with nitrogen
charged long travel
shocks for a near Cadillac
ride offroad.

M.O.R.E
1" aluminum body
lift:
In
order to gain the needed
clearance for 33"
tires with only
2.5" of suspension
lift we went to M.O.R.E
for one of there
reputable aluminum body
lift kits. Easy
installation and top
notch quality kit
provided us with just
enough extra lift to
clear the larger tires. Project

RoCk
SkuLLz offroad
Hammerhead bumper:
A
beefy bumper from RoCk
SkuLLz products was
added to the front of
project willys. Features
welded clevis mounts,
marker lights, with
several light mount
options. Bolted right
onto the factory mounts.
